🚀 币安 - 全球最大加密货币交易所-<<点击注册>
💰 注册即享 20% 手续费返佣优惠
🔑 专属邀请码: RFHBT7IA
以太坊的Layer 2与Celo的超轻客户端:深度解析与对比
在区块链世界里,以太坊和Celo都是备受瞩目的项目,各自拥有独特的技术和创新。其中,以太坊的Layer 2扩容方案和Celo的超轻客户端是它们在解决区块链可扩展性问题上所采取的不同策略。本文将深入探讨这两种技术的区别,帮助你更好地理解它们各自的优劣和应用场景。
币安作为世界上最大的加密货币交易所,非常值得信赖,点击注册填写邀请码RFHBT7IA获得全网最大返佣!
一、以太坊的Layer 2扩容方案
以太坊的Layer 2扩容方案,顾名思义,是构建在以太坊主链之上的第二层网络,旨在提升交易处理能力,降低交易成本。Layer 2技术主要有侧链、状态通道、汇总(Rollup)等。其中,Optimism和 Arbitrum是目前最流行的以太坊Layer 2解决方案。
1.1 侧链
侧链是独立于主链的区块链,通过跨链协议与主链进行通信。侧链可以处理大量交易,然后将结果打包成一个较小的证明(证明链上发生了什么),提交给主链确认。这种方式可以显著提高交易速度,但跨链操作可能带来安全风险。
1.2 状态通道
状态通道是一种点对点的协议,允许两个参与者在链下进行多次交易,只在最后将交易结果上链。这极大地减少了主链的交易压力,但需要双方保持在线,否则交易可能需要重新开始。
1.3 汇总(Rollup)
Rollup是一种将大量交易打包成一个较小的交易,然后在主链上验证其正确性的方法。Rollup分为两种类型:Optimistic Rollup和ZK-Rollup。Optimistic Rollup允许任何用户挑战错误的交易,而ZK-Rollup则通过零知识证明来保证交易的正确性,但后者通常更安全,但技术复杂度更高。
二、Celo的超轻客户端
Celo 是一个旨在为全球用户提供低门槛、低成本的加密货币体验的平台。为了实现这一目标,Celo 引入了超轻客户端技术,让手机用户无需下载整个区块链就能参与网络。
2.1 超轻客户端原理
超轻客户端依赖于可信的第三方(称为验证者)来提供区块链数据的摘要。用户只需验证这些摘要,而不需要下载整个区块链。这大大降低了手机用户的存储和计算需求,提高了用户体验。
2.2 Celo 的安全模型
Celo 采用了一种名为“Proof of Stake with Inflationary Rewards”的共识机制,结合了权益证明(PoS)和通货膨胀奖励,以激励验证者提供准确的区块链摘要。同时,Celo 还有一个专门的治理机制来处理潜在的欺诈行为。
三、区别与对比
3.1 扩容效果
Layer 2 方案在以太坊上可以实现显著的扩容,处理大量交易,而Celo 的超轻客户端则主要关注手机用户的轻量化体验,而非大规模交易处理。
3.2 技术复杂度
Layer 2 技术如Rollup涉及更复杂的零知识证明或挑战机制,而Celo 的超轻客户端依赖于验证者的信任,技术相对简单。
3.3 安全性
虽然Celo的超轻客户端依赖第三方验证者,但其设计了一套治理机制来确保数据的准确性。而Layer 2方案的安全性取决于所采用的具体技术,如ZK-Rollup提供更高的安全性。
3.4 用户体验
Celo的超轻客户端特别适合手机用户,降低了参与门槛,而Layer 2方案可能需要用户安装专用的轻量级钱包。
四、应用场景
以太坊的Layer 2方案更适合于需要大量交易处理的DApp和DeFi应用,如去中心化交易所和借贷平台。而Celo则更适用于希望提供低门槛加密货币体验的项目,特别是在发展中国家,手机用户占比较大。
五、结论
以太坊的Layer 2和Celo的超轻客户端是两种不同的扩容策略,各有优劣。Layer 2技术旨在通过在主链外处理交易来提升性能,而Celo则通过轻量化客户端来降低用户参与门槛。选择哪种技术取决于项目的需求和目标用户群体。无论你是一名开发者还是投资者,理解这些技术的差异都能帮助你更好地评估项目潜力和风险。
通过本文的指南,相信你已经了解了一部分加密货币的知识,现在赶快填写邀请码RFHBT7IA开始你在币安交易所的数字资产之旅吧!
🎁通过本文的指南,相信你已经了解了一部分加密货币的知识,币安作为世界上最大的加密货币交易所,非常值得信赖,👉点击优惠链接进行注册填写邀请码RFHBT7IA获得全网最大返佣!👈
关键词:区块链, DeFi, Layer 2, 交易所, 钱包